1//! Create User API helper
2//!
3//! This module wraps the **Auth0 Management API v2 – Create User** endpoint
4//! (<https://auth0.com/docs/api/management/v2/users/post-users>).
5//!
6//! # Example
7//! ```ignore
8//! use your_crate::users::{CreateUserRequest, create_user};
9//! use your_crate::token::BearerToken;
10//! use your_crate::domain::Domain;
11//! use std::env;
12//!
13// ! #[tokio::main]
14// ! async fn main() -> anyhow::Result<()> {
15// !     let token = BearerToken::new(env::var("MGMT_API_TOKEN")?)?;
16// !     let domain = Domain::new(env::var("AUTH0_DOMAIN")?)?;
17// !
18// !     let req = CreateUserRequest::builder()
19// !         .email("user@example.com")
20// !         .connection("Username-Password-Authentication")
21// !         .password("SecureP@ssword123!")
22// !         .given_name("John")
23// !         .family_name("Doe")
24// !         .verify_email(true)
25// !         .build()?;
26// !
27// !     let user = create_user(&domain, &token, req).await?;
28// !     println!("Created user: {} (id = {})", user.email, user.user_id);
29// !     Ok(())
30// ! }
31//! ```
32use crate::{
33    domain::Domain,
34    error::{Auth0Error, Result},
35    token::BearerToken,
36};
37use reqwest::Client;
38use serde::{Deserialize, Serialize};
39use serde_json::Value;
40
41#[derive(Debug, Default, Serialize, Deserialize)]
42pub struct CreateUserRequest {
43    /// The user's email address.
44    pub email: String,
45
46    /// The connection to create the user in (e.g. "Username-Password-Authentication").
47    pub connection: String,
48
49    /// The user's password, if applicable.
50    #[serde(skip_serializing_if = "Option::is_none")]
51    pub password: Option<String>,
52
53    /// The user's given name.
54    #[serde(skip_serializing_if = "Option::is_none")]
55    pub given_name: Option<String>,
56
57    /// The user's family name.
58    #[serde(skip_serializing_if = "Option::is_none")]
59    pub family_name: Option<String>,
60
61    /// The user's full name.
62    #[serde(skip_serializing_if = "Option::is_none")]
63    pub name: Option<String>,
64
65    /// The user's nickname.
66    #[serde(skip_serializing_if = "Option::is_none")]
67    pub nickname: Option<String>,
68
69    /// URL pointing to the user's picture.
70    #[serde(skip_serializing_if = "Option::is_none")]
71    pub picture: Option<String>,
72
73    /// Whether the user's id is verified.
74    #[serde(skip_serializing_if = "Option::is_none")]
75    pub user_id: Option<String>,
76
77    /// Whether the user's email is verified.
78    #[serde(skip_serializing_if = "Option::is_none")]
79    pub email_verified: Option<bool>,
80
81    /// The user's phone number (E.164 format).
82    #[serde(skip_serializing_if = "Option::is_none")]
83    pub phone_number: Option<String>,
84
85    /// Whether the user's phone number is verified.
86    #[serde(skip_serializing_if = "Option::is_none")]
87    pub phone_verified: Option<bool>,
88
89    /// Additional metadata for the user.
90    #[serde(skip_serializing_if = "Option::is_none")]
91    pub user_metadata: Option<Value>,
92
93    /// App-specific metadata.
94    #[serde(skip_serializing_if = "Option::is_none")]
95    pub app_metadata: Option<Value>,
96
97    /// Whether the user is blocked.
98    #[serde(skip_serializing_if = "Option::is_none")]
99    pub blocked: Option<bool>,
100
101    /// Whether to send a verification email to the user.
102    #[serde(skip_serializing_if = "Option::is_none")]
103    pub verify_email: Option<bool>,
104}
105
106impl CreateUserRequest {
107    pub fn builder() -> CreateUserRequestBuilder {
108        CreateUserRequestBuilder::default()
109    }

314
315/// Call the Auth0 Management API to create a new user.
316///
317/// * `domain` – The Auth0 domain (e.g. `my-tenant.eu.auth0.com`).
318/// * `token` – Bearer token with `create:users` scope.
319/// * `request` – Body describing the user.
320pub async fn create_user(
321    domain: &Domain,
322    token: &BearerToken,
323    request: CreateUserRequest,
324) -> Result<CreateUserResponse> {
325    let url = domain.to_url("/api/v2/users");
326
327    let resp = Client::new()
328        .post(url)
329        .bearer_auth(token.as_str())
330        .header("Content-Type", "application/json")
331        .json(&request)
332        .send()
333        .await?;
334
335    if resp.status().is_success() {
336        let user = resp.json::<CreateUserResponse>().await?;
337        Ok(user)
338    } else {
339        Err(Auth0Error::from_response(resp).await)
340    }
341}
